Cost of living in Hobbs summary. We use data on the cost of living to determine how expensive it is to live in Hobbs. Real estate prices drive most of the variance in cost of living around New Mexico. Key points include:

  • The cost of living in Hobbs is 91 with 100 being average.

  • The cost of living in Hobbs is 0.9x lower than the national average.

  • The median home value in Hobbs is $207,135.

  • The median income in Hobbs is $64,021.

Hobbs, NM Weather

  • The average high in Hobbs is 75.7° and the average low is 46.8°.

  • There are 30.3 days of precipitation each year.

  • Expect an average of 15.3 inches of precipitation each year with 3.8 inches of snow.

Population over time in Hobbs

The current population in Hobbs is 40,252. The population has increased 22.2% from 2010.

Year Population % Change
2024 40,252 0.9%
2023 39,887 0.3%
2022 39,782 0.8%
2021 39,476 2.6%
2020 38,475 0.3%
2019 38,375 0.8%
2018 38,052 1.7%
2017 37,427 1.5%
2016 36,863 1.9%
2015 36,191 2.4%
2014 35,343 1.9%
2013 34,684 1.7%
2012 34,111 1.6%
2011 33,578 1.9%
2010 32,940 -

Race Hobbs NM USA
White 28.2% 36.0% 57.4%
African American 5.1% 1.8% 11.9%
American Indian 0.6% 8.5% 0.5%
Asian 1.0% 1.6% 5.9%
Hawaiian 0.0% 0.1% 0.2%
Other 0.2% 0.5% 0.6%
Two Or More 2.0% 3.1% 4.3%
Hispanic 62.9% 48.4% 19.3%
